Energy Minister Temenuzhka Petkova has returned from Moscow where she took part in a meeting of the joint working group set up in connection with the ruling of the Court of Arbitration on the aborted Belene NPP.
“I hope that things will have been cleared up by the end of the month and we want the payment to have taken place by the end of the year,” Minister Petkova said. Under the Court of Arbitration ruling Bulgaria owes Russia 620 million euro, plus 167,000 euro in interest for each day of delay for the equipment manufactured for the aborted Belene NPP.
